Vannes is a commune in the French department of Morbihan, Brittany, northwestern mainland France. It was founded over 2,000 years ago. From Wikipedia
The trial of Joël Le Scouarnec, accused of sexually abusing 299 victims, reveals harrowing testimonies and evidence of meticulously documented crimes.